Reliance, Disney merge to form Rs 70,000-cr JV

Reliance, Disney merge to form Rs 70,000-cr JV

Rediff.com14 Nov 2024

Billionaire Mukesh Ambani-led Reliance Industries has completed the merger of its media assets with the India business of global media house Walt Disney and formed a joint venture with a valuation of over Rs 70,000 crore. The JV will be one of the largest media and entertainment companies in India with a combined revenue of approximately Rs 26,000 crore and will be led by Nita Ambani as its chairperson, according to a joint statement.
